That large tube that goes across the valve cover goes to the PCV flame trap. The black things in the first pic is what a flame trap looks like. It's regularly what gets clogged. The honey comb is what clogs. I took mine out years ago. The trap goes on the elbow (highlighted in yellow in the second pic). That is between the 3rd and 4th runner on the intake manifold. If your car is a non turbo it may be different, but I would think that the trap is in about the same location. The oil separator is under the intake. It's less likely to clog.
